Science 2.8
Earth and space. The student knows that there are recognizable patterns in the natural world and among objects in the sky. The student is expected to:
- (1) measure, record, and graph weather information,
including temperature, wind conditions, precipitation, and cloud coverage, in
order to identify patterns in the data;
- (A) identify the importance of weather and seasonal information to make choices in clothing, activities, and transportation; and
- (B) observe, describe, and record patterns of objects in the sky, including the appearance of the Moon.
